Chosen by their vocal ability, EOC’s Blue and Gold singers brought many hours of pleasure both to campus inhabitants and the townspeople. Bach’s Christmas Oratorio was presented and enjoyed tremendously during this year’s Yuletide season. Making outstanding performances for the EOC production were Dave Skeen, baritone; Sylvia Thompson, alto; Ardyce Garrett, pianist; Neil Wilson, director; Mrs. Jack Vedder, organist; Howard Anderson, tenor; and Patsy Hutchinson, soprano. The Christmas Oratorio was composed in 1734 during Bach’s period of service as organist and choir master at the St. Thomas School in Leipzig. The work is divided into six parts to be performed respectively on the first, second, and third days of the Festival of Christmas, on New Year’s Day, on the Sunday after this, and on the Festival of the Epiphony. Each of the six parts is a cantata, complete and independent of the other five sections, yet unmistakably linked with them in style and mood.
